Technical Problem

In existing technologies, the connection strength of prefabricated smoke exhaust ducts is insufficient, making them prone to skewing and poor sealing. Furthermore, long-term contact between the duct and the support can cause deformation, affecting the performance.

Method used

The structure employs reinforced protrusions, positioning screws, and shock-absorbing springs to enhance the strength and stability of the duct connection. It improves splicing accuracy through interlocking and threaded connections, and uses shock-absorbing springs to buffer the tension of the supports and hangers, preventing duct deformation and shaking.

Benefits of technology

It improves the strength and stability of duct connections, prevents skewing and deformation, enhances sealing and the buffering effect of supports and hangers, and ensures the normal operation of the duct system.

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of duct technology, specifically to an integrated prefabricated smoke exhaust duct. Background Technology

[0002] Smoke control and exhaust systems consist of supply and exhaust ducts, shafts, fire dampers, door opening and closing devices, supply and exhaust fans, etc. Smoke control systems are typically set up in positive pressure configurations in stairwells. The smoke exhaust volume of a mechanical smoke exhaust system is directly related to the smoke control zoning. Smoke control facilities in high-rise buildings should be divided into mechanical pressurized air supply systems and natural smoke exhaust systems with operable windows. Air ducts are piping systems used for air transport and distribution. There are two types: composite air ducts and inorganic air ducts. They can be classified according to cross-sectional shape and material. Stainless steel air duct fabrication involves applying sealant (such as neutral silicone sealant) to seams, rivet seams, and the four corners of flanges. Before applying the sealant, surface dust and oil should be removed. According to cross-sectional shape, air ducts can be divided into circular air ducts, rectangular air ducts, and flat oval air ducts, etc. Among them, circular air ducts have the lowest resistance but the largest height dimension and are more complex to manufacture; therefore, rectangular air ducts are mainly used.

[0003] In the prior art, application number 202222932859.9 discloses an integrated prefabricated smoke exhaust duct panel, including a panel body with sealing strips installed around the perimeter. The panel body has assembly devices on its interior and exterior surfaces. The above-mentioned devices are assembled and spliced ​​using simple clamps and plates. This method greatly reduces the strength of the smoke exhaust duct connection, especially at the splice point of two ducts, where skewing is likely to occur, and the sealing and load-bearing capacity of the splice are poor. Furthermore, the duct needs to be protected by a protective bracket installed on the outside during use. The long-term reinforcement and suspension of the protective bracket can cause the duct to deform due to prolonged pressure between the duct and the installation position of the protective bracket.

[0024] According to an embodiment of the present invention, an integrated prefabricated smoke exhaust duct is provided.

[0025] Example 1

[0026] like Figure 1-4As shown, an integrated prefabricated smoke exhaust duct according to an embodiment of the present utility model includes a duct body 1, a first mounting frame plate 2, and a second mounting frame plate 3. The left end of the duct body 1 is fixedly connected to the right side of the first mounting frame plate 2, and the right end of the duct body 1 is fixedly connected to the left side of the inner wall of the second mounting frame plate 3. An assembly frame 4 is fitted on the outside of the duct body 1. Reinforcing protrusions 5 are fixedly connected to the four sides of the outer wall of the second mounting frame plate 3. The first mounting frame plate 2 includes an outer frame 6 and a fixed frame 7. The right side of the outer frame 6 is fixedly connected to the fixed frame 7, and the right side of the fixed frame 7 is fixedly connected to the left side of the duct body 1. Fitting grooves 8 are excavated on the four sides of the inner wall of the outer frame 6. The structure matches the structure of the reinforcing protrusion 5 and fits tightly and movably against the outer wall of the reinforcing protrusion 5. When multiple duct bodies 1 are spliced ​​and assembled, the second mounting frame plate 3 at the right end of one duct body 1 enters the interior of the first mounting frame plate 2 at the left end of another duct body 1. The reinforcing protrusion 5 is provided around the outer wall of the second mounting frame plate 3. The reinforcing protrusion 5 can improve the strength of the splice of the first mounting frame plate 2 and the second mounting frame plate 3, and prevent the connection from being easily deformed and unable to be disassembled. In addition, the reinforcing protrusion 5 will be embedded in the fitting groove 8 on the inner wall of another second mounting frame plate 3, which can make the splicing operation of adjacent duct bodies 1 more precise and prevent the docking from being misaligned.

[0029] Example 3

[0030] like Figure 1-4As shown, an integrated prefabricated smoke exhaust duct according to an embodiment of the present invention includes a duct body 1, a first mounting frame plate 2, and a second mounting frame plate 3. The left end of the duct body 1 is fixedly connected to the right side of the first mounting frame plate 2, and the right end of the duct body 1 is fixedly connected to the left side of the inner wall of the second mounting frame plate 3. An assembly frame 4 is fitted on the outer side of the duct body 1. Reinforcing protrusions 5 are fixedly connected to the four sides of the outer wall of the second mounting frame plate 3. A movable frame 11 is movably fitted on the outer wall of the duct body 1. A connecting groove 13 is dug on the bottom side of the movable frame 11, and the connecting groove 13 penetrates both sides of the movable frame 11. Symmetrical through holes 14 are provided on the top side of the inner wall of the connecting groove 13, and the through holes 14 penetrate the top side of the movable frame 11. A hanger is provided inside the through hole 14. 15. The hanger 15 is slidably connected to the inner wall of the through hole 14. The bottom end of the hanger 15 is fixedly connected to the limiting plate 16. The top side of the limiting plate 16 is fixedly connected to the shock-absorbing spring 17. The shock-absorbing spring 17 is sleeved on the outside of the hanger 15, and its top end is fixedly connected to the top side of the inner wall of the connecting groove 13. The position of the movable frame 11 can be flexibly adjusted. The support bracket set on the outside of the smoke exhaust duct is embedded into the connecting groove 13 at the bottom of the movable frame 11. Pressure is applied to the limiting plate 16, so that the support bracket does not directly contact the outer wall of the smoke exhaust duct, increasing the contact area between the support bracket and the smoke exhaust duct. Under the action of the shock-absorbing spring 17, the lifting force of the support bracket can be buffered, avoiding the situation where the smoke exhaust duct sways up and down, causing the suspended position to collapse or deform.
